New Study Showcases Top Arab Websites

September 04 2008

A recently completed study on internet websites in the Middle East showcases the established market leaders in this regional market, but indicates there is still much room for growth.

Findings of the study prepared by World IT Report showed that while established web destinations continue to dominate the key market segments, some niches still remain underserved.

Maktoob.com is the market leader for email, as it has been since its establishment; Albawaba.com (including its various sub-brands such as Sharekna.com, Music.albawaba.com and Menareport.com) continues to dominate the content category by a wide lead; Koora.com has the lead in sports; and Aljazeera.net is top in news broadcasting.

However, there are still several areas which lack clear market leaders, especially niches targeting specific demographics and areas of interest. This situation is mostly a result
of the hesitation among traditional print publishers in the region to enter the online market, combined with the limited and nationally-focused outlook of many of the efforts that have been made so far.

By contrast, the usage habits of Arab internet users are well advanced. Extensive use is made of the internet for communications (voice and text), socializing, and e-commerce, as well as work and information search.
